When our family embarked on an in-person tour of Poet's Walk, we had high hopes for finding the perfect place for our beloved mom. Although it was our second choice, the experience turned out to be quite wonderful. The community appeared pristine and relatively new during our visit, emanating a sense of freshness and warmth.

Our initial interaction with one of the staff members left us slightly skeptical. This particular individual seemed overly focused on making sales and providing all the "right answers." While her eagerness to please was commendable, it did raise some doubts within us. We preferred a more genuine approach that would help us make an informed decision based on honesty rather than mere sales tactics.

Fortunately, our concerns were quickly alleviated as we interacted with other members of the Poet's Walk team. The rest of the staff exhibited sincere helpfulness and willingness to assist us in any way possible. They patiently answered all our questions, addressing any concerns we had about their facility and care services. It was evident that they genuinely cared about the well-being of their residents.

Although Poet's Walk ultimately wasn't the ideal fit for our mother, we believe it could be a wonderful option for many other individuals seeking assisted living or memory care communities. Poets Walk Warrenton Va, located in Warrenton, VA, is an assisted living community that offers a range of amenities and care services to ensure the well-being of its residents. The community provides devotional services off-site, allowing residents to practice their faith and engage in spiritual activities outside the premises. Indoor common areas are also available, providing communal spaces where residents can socialize and relax.

In terms of care services, Poets Walk Warrenton Va offers specialized diabetic care to meet the unique needs of residents with diabetes. This includes assistance with managing medications, monitoring blood sugar levels, and promoting a healthy lifestyle to prevent complications.

Residents at Poets Walk Warrenton Va can also enjoy a variety of activities designed to enhance their physical, mental, and emotional well-being. Devotional activities offsite allow residents to continue practicing their faith within their community. Additionally, the community is conveniently located near various cafes, pharmacies, physicians' offices, restaurants, places of worship, and hospitals.

Overall Poets Walk Warrenton Va provides a comfortable and supportive environment for seniors in need of assisted living services in the Warrenton area.
